Stir Fried Pork and Onion with Gochujang
- 1 Onion
- 200 grams Thinly sliced pork belly
- 2 tbsp Sake
- 1 Salt and pepper
- 2 tbsp Katakuriko
- 1 tbsp Sugar
- 1 and 1/2 tablespoons Mentsuyu
- 1 tbsp Soy sauce
- 1 tbsp Gochujang
- 2 to 3 tablespoons Sesame oil (1 tablespoon for seasoning)
- 1 Ground sesame seeds
- Peel the onion, cut it half, and slice.
- Coat the pork with ingredients.
- Mix the ingredients well in a bowl.
- Heat a pan with sesame oil.
- Saute the onion over medium heat.
- Add the pork.
- When they have browned, add the mixed ingredients, and pour the sesame oil.
- Serve to a plate, and sprinkle in the ground sesame seeds.
- It's done.
